Our website uses cookies. By continuing we assume your permission to deploy cookies.Close

Store Image Description Price
Daylesford Organic Pumpkin Seeds 500g
£7.90
category:Groceriescategory:Food Cupboardname:500gname:pumpkinname:organicname:seedsname:daylesford
get graph image